Why Replace Your Doors and Windows?
Boosted Energy Efficiency
Out-of-date doors and windows can lead to drafts, air leakages, and higher energy costs as your heating or cooling system works overtime to maintain a comfy indoor temperature level. Modern replacements feature energy-efficient products like double or triple-pane glass, low-E finishes, and insulated frames, which minimize energy loss and keep your home comfortable year-round.
Improved Security
Older doors and windows may lack the necessary locking mechanisms or structural stability to keep your home safe. New replacement alternatives typically consist of strengthened glass, multi-point locking systems, and durable products like fiberglass or steel, providing assurance versus potential break-ins.
Suppress Appeal and Value
Changing an old, worn-out front door or a dated window style immediately revitalizes your home's exterior appearance. Whether you're opting for smooth modern-day components or timeless, timeless designs, new doors and windows enhance curb appeal and can substantially increase residential or commercial property value.
Decreased Maintenance
New materials often include weather-resistant surfaces and need less maintenance compared to older styles. For example, vinyl windows and fiberglass doors withstand warping, rot, and rust-- making them ideal for those who desire low-maintenance upgrades.
Noise Reduction
If you live near hectic streets or city locations, replacing older windows or doors with soundproofing technologies can visibly reduce outside sound, creating a quieter and more tranquil living area.
Picking the Right Material
When it comes to door or window replacement, the product makes all the distinction. Here prevail materials you can select from:
Vinyl: Cost-effective, resilient, and practically maintenance-free, vinyl is an outstanding option for window replacements. It provides excellent insulation and resists warping or breaking gradually.
Wood: For a more traditional or rustic look, wood is a timeless choice. While gorgeous and energy-efficient, door Windows Replacement wood needs routine upkeep to avoid rot and warping.
Fiberglass: Durable, energy-efficient, and personalized, fiberglass doors and windows provide the very best of both worlds: strength and looks. They can mimic wood without the maintenance hassles.
Steel: Offering first-class security and durability, steel is a popular choice for entry doors. It holds up well versus severe weather however can be susceptible to damages.
Aluminum: Lightweight and streamlined, aluminum is great for contemporary styles. Nevertheless, it's less energy-efficient compared to other materials and may not perform too in severe climates.
Cost Considerations
The cost of door with sliding window windows replacement; please click the following page, and window replacements depends upon different aspects, including the size, materials, personalization, and complexity of setup. Here's a general breakdown:
Windows: On average, replacing windows can cost $300 to $1,200 per window, depending on the material and functions. Adding custom sizes, energy-efficient coatings, or specialty styles will increase the expense.
Doors: Standard door replacement ranges from $500 to $2,000 per door. Entry doors, security doors, and sliding glass doors (which require larger panes of glass) tend to be more pricey.
While the in advance costs might appear high, keep in mind that energy-efficient windows and Door Windows Replacement doors can help you save considerably on your energy bills in time, ultimately balancing out the initial financial investment.
The Installation Process
Changing aluminium windows & doors and doors is a job finest left to specialists, however comprehending the process can help ensure everything goes efficiently.
Assessment and Measurement: A professional specialist will examine your current doors and upvc windows and doors, evaluate the condition of the existing frames, and take accurate measurements to make sure the replacements fit correctly.
Picking Styles and Features: Once the measurements are taken, you'll have the opportunity to select the design, material, and additional features, such as energy-efficient glass or ornamental details.
Removal of Old Units: The installers will remove your old doors or windows carefully to avoid unneeded damage to the surrounding frames, walls, or floor covering.
Setup of Replacements: New doors or windows are installed, sealed, and checked to ensure correct positioning, performance, and energy performance.
Last Clean-Up and Inspection: Once the job is complete, the worksite is cleaned up, and the professionals will walk you through the results to guarantee everything fulfills your expectations.
DIY vs Professional Installation
While DIY door and window replacement may appear like a cost-saving alternative, it's not constantly advisable unless you have proficient know-how and specialized tools. Incorrect setup can result in air leakages, water damage, and structural problems. Working with certified specialists makes sure the job is finished quickly and correctly, typically with service warranties for added security.
